DLL使用

(1)隱式連結到 DLL 的可運行檔案在產生時連結到匯入庫(.lib檔案)。

(2)採用顯式串連(LoadLibrary和GetProcAddress)時,不須要.lib檔案。

函數匯出方式

(1)源碼中的 __declspec(dllexport) keyword 
(2).def 檔案裡的 EXPORTS 語句 
(3)LINK 命令中的 /EXPORT 規範 
全部這三種方法能夠用在同一個程式中。

LINK 在產生包括匯出的程式時還建立匯入庫,除非產生中使用了 .exp 檔案。


匯出

CppDynamicLinkLibrary.cpp

#include "CppDynamicLinkLibrary.h"#include <strsafe.h>#pragma region DLLMainBOOL APIENTRY DllMain(HMODULE hModule,                      DWORD  ul_reason_for_call,                      LPVOID lpReserved                      ){switch (ul_reason_for_call){case DLL_PROCESS_ATTACH:case DLL_THREAD_ATTACH:case DLL_THREAD_DETACH:case DLL_PROCESS_DETACH:break;}return TRUE;}#pragma endregion#pragma region Global Data// An exported/imported global data using a DEF file// Initialize it to be 1int g_nVal1 = 1;// An exported/imported global data using __declspec(dllexport/dllimport)// Initialize it to be 2SYMBOL_DECLSPEC int g_nVal2 = 2;#pragma endregion#pragma region Ordinary Functions// An exported/imported cdecl(default) function using a DEF fileint /*__cdecl*/ GetStringLength1(PCWSTR pszString){    return static_cast<int>(wcslen(pszString));}// An exported/imported stdcall function using __declspec(dllexport/dllimport)SYMBOL_DECLSPEC int __stdcall GetStringLength2(PCWSTR pszString){    return static_cast<int>(wcslen(pszString));}#pragma endregion#pragma region Callback Function// An exported/imported stdcall function using a DEF file// It requires a callback function as one of the argumentsint __stdcall CompareInts(int a, int b, PFN_COMPARE cmpFunc){// Make the callback to the comparison function// If a is greater than b, return a;     // If b is greater than or equal to a, return b.    return ((*cmpFunc)(a, b) > 0) ? a : b;}#pragma endregion#pragma region Class// Constructor of the simple C++ classCSimpleObject::CSimpleObject(void) : m_fField(0.0f){}// Destructor of the simple C++ classCSimpleObject::~CSimpleObject(void){}float CSimpleObject::get_FloatProperty(void){return this->m_fField;}void CSimpleObject::set_FloatProperty(float newVal){this->m_fField = newVal;}HRESULT CSimpleObject::ToString(PWSTR pszBuffer, DWORD dwSize){    return StringCchPrintf(pszBuffer, dwSize, L"%.2f", this->m_fField);}int CSimpleObject::GetStringLength(PCWSTR pszString){    return static_cast<int>(wcslen(pszString));}#pragma endregion


CppDynamicLinkLibrary.def

LIBRARY   CppDynamicLinkLibraryEXPORTS   GetStringLength1     @1   CompareInts  @2   g_nVal1DATA
